Dennis Orcollo, Roberto Gomez triumph in World 8-Ball Championship
April 22, 2008
Dennis Orcollo and Roberto Gomez bounced back from the one-loss side by posting huge victories to barge into the knockout stage of the 2008 World 8-Ball Championship late Monday at the Amir Billiards Club in Fujairah City, United Arab Emirates .
Orcollo, the current world’s top-ranked cue artist and last year’s runner-up, saw his quest of finally becoming a world champion on the brink after absorbing a close 8-6 loss to Englishman Mark Gray, but he immediately recovered with an 8-2 trashing of New Zealand’s Matt Edwards to secure a slot to the round-of-32 of this eight-day event.
Gomez, the 2007 World Pool Championship runner-up, rebounded from his sorry second round defeat to reigning World 10-Ball titlist Shane Van Boening by blanking Canadian Francis Crevier, 8-0, to also join fellow Billiards Managers and Players Association of the Philippines bets defending champion Ronnie Alcano and Warren Kiamco in the KO phase.
